ENVIRONMENTAL PROTECTION AGENCY

[EPA-HQ-OPPT-2003-0004; FRL-10937-01-OCSPP]


Access to Confidential Business Information; Industrial 
Economics, Incorporated

AGENCY: Environmental Protection Agency (EPA).

ACTION: Notice.

-----------------------------------------------------------------------

SUMMARY: This notice announces that information submitted to EPA under 
the Toxic Substances Control Act (TSCA), including information that may 
have been claimed as or determined to be Confidential Business 
Information (CBI), will be transferred to its contractor Industrial 
Economics, Incorporated (IEc) of Cambridge, MA in accordance with the 
CBI regulations. Access to this information will enable the contractor 
to fulfill the obligations of the contract with EPA.

DATES: Access to the information will occur no sooner than May 26, 
2023.

II. Contract Requirements

    Under EPA contract number 68HERC23D0020, contractor Industrial 
Economics, Incorporated (IEc), located at 2067 Massachusetts Avenue, 
Cambridge, MA 02140, will assist the Office of Pollution Prevention and 
Toxics (OPPT) by conducting financial and economic analyses in TSCA 
enforcement actions and will also review tax returns, financial 
statements, and other information that may contain CBI.
    In accordance with 40 CFR 2.306(j), EPA has determined that the 
personnel of this contractor will require access to CBI submitted to 
EPA under all sections of TSCA to perform successfully the duties 
specified under the contract. EPA is issuing this notice to inform all 
submitters of information to EPA under all sections of TSCA that EPA 
will provide this contractor with access to these CBI materials on a 
need-to-know basis only. All access to TSCA CBI under this contract 
will take place at EPA Headquarters, the contractor's site, located at 
2067 Massachusetts Avenue, Cambridge, MA 02140, and at telework 
locations of EPA and contractor personnel in accordance with EPA's TSCA 
CBI Protection Manual and the Rules of Behavior for Virtual Desktop 
Access to OPPT Materials, including TSCA CBI. All personnel will be 
required to sign nondisclosure agreements and will be briefed on 
specific security procedures for TSCA CBI.
    Access to TSCA data, including CBI, will continue until April 2, 
2028. If the contract is extended, this access will also continue for 
the duration of the extended contract without further notice.
    Authority: 15 U.S.C. 2601 et seq.
